Ferrari: We still have a lot to learn about the tyres

4 March, 2013 Fernando Alonso during testing in Barcelona The twelve days of testing at Jerez and Barcelona on offer to Scuderia Ferrari and the other ten teams have gone quickly. There were six days of running for Felipe Massa, five for Fernando Alonso and one for Pedro de la Rosa in just about every kind of weather, except perhaps the conditions expected at the season opener in Melbourne on 17 March. Together Massa and Alonso completed a total of 1069 laps of the two Spanish tracks: 3682km from the last two sessions at the Catalunya circuit plus a further 1231km in Jerez making up a total of 4913km.
